Use your own knowledge to compare and contrast the physical and chemical properties of Transition metals and group 2 elements. Use examples to explain your answer.

Answer: Students should be able to list the typical properties of transition metals Physicalhigh melting point / DensityFormation of coloured compoundsFormation of ions with different chargesChemicalLow reactivityused as catalystsand contrast / compare these with Group 1 PhysicalLow melting pointshigh DensitySoftChemicalVery reactive with water and non-metalsNot used as catalystsOnly form a 1+ ionAny example given is good, such as "Potassium reacts with water to produce Potassium hydroxide" or the use of "Iron as catalyst in Haber Process".
